Why Does My Sewing Machine Keep Jamming?
- Jul 17
- 9 min read
If you have ever stopped mid-project and asked, “Why does my sewing machine keep jamming?” you are not alone. Sewing machine jams are one of the most common problems sewists face, whether they are beginners learning basic stitches or experienced users working with advanced machines. A jam can show up as tangled thread under the fabric, a stuck handwheel, skipped stitches, broken needles, loud clunking sounds, or fabric that refuses to move. While it can be frustrating, a sewing machine jam is usually not random. It is often the machine’s way of telling you that something in the threading, tension, needle, bobbin, fabric handling, or maintenance routine needs attention.
Understanding why jams happen is important because forcing the machine can turn a small issue into a larger repair problem. The good news is that many jams can be corrected with careful troubleshooting and routine maintenance. By learning how the upper thread, bobbin thread, needle, feed system, and hook mechanism work together, you can prevent many common issues and keep your machine sewing smoothly.
What Does It Mean When a Sewing Machine Jams?
A sewing machine jam occurs when the machine’s normal stitch-forming process is interrupted. In a properly working machine, the needle carries the upper thread down through the fabric, the hook catches the thread loop, the bobbin thread is pulled into the stitch, and the feed dogs move the fabric forward. When one part of that sequence fails, thread can bunch, fabric can lock in place, and the machine may stop moving.
Common signs of a jam include:
Thread nesting or bunching underneath the fabric
Fabric getting pulled into the needle plate
A needle that will not move up or down
The handwheel becoming difficult or impossible to turn
Bobbin thread tangling inside the bobbin case
Loud knocking, clicking, or grinding sounds
Stitches suddenly becoming uneven or skipped
Thread repeatedly breaking
A jam does not always mean the machine is broken. Often, it means the machine has been threaded incorrectly, the needle is damaged, the bobbin is not seated properly, or lint has built up around the bobbin area. However, repeated jams should not be ignored, especially if the machine continues to lock up after basic corrections.
Incorrect Threading Is a Leading Cause of Jams
One of the most common reasons a sewing machine keeps jamming is incorrect threading. Even a small missed guide can affect how the thread moves through the machine. If the upper thread is not seated correctly in the tension discs, the machine may not control the thread properly. This can cause loose loops to form underneath the fabric, often called “bird nesting.”
To reduce threading-related jams:
Always thread the machine with the presser foot raised
Follow the threading path exactly as shown in the manual
Make sure the thread is seated between the tension discs
Confirm the thread passes through the take-up lever
Use quality thread that is not old, weak, fuzzy, or uneven
Rethread the machine completely if a jam occurs
Threading with the presser foot raised is especially important because it opens the tension discs. If the presser foot is lowered while threading, the thread may sit outside the tension system. The machine may appear threaded correctly, but it will not sew correctly.
Bobbin Problems Can Cause Thread Bunching
The bobbin system plays a major role in stitch formation. If the bobbin is wound unevenly, inserted backward, placed in the wrong case, or not pulled through the proper tension path, the machine can jam quickly. Bobbin issues are especially common when thread bunches underneath the fabric.
Check the bobbin area if your machine keeps jamming. Look for:
A bobbin inserted in the wrong direction
A bobbin that is not fully seated
Loose thread tails caught in the bobbin case
An overfilled or unevenly wound bobbin
The wrong bobbin size or style for the machine
Lint, thread pieces, or debris under the needle plate
Damage to the bobbin case or hook area
Not all bobbins are interchangeable. Two bobbins may look similar but differ slightly in height, diameter, edge shape, or material. Using the wrong bobbin can affect tension and timing, leading to jams and inconsistent stitches. Always use the bobbin type recommended for your specific machine model.
Needle Issues Often Lead to Jamming
A needle may seem like a small part, but it has a major effect on machine performance. A dull, bent, damaged, or incorrect needle can cause skipped stitches, thread shredding, fabric snagging, and jams. Needles wear out faster than many sewists realize, especially when sewing thick fabrics, dense seams, synthetic materials, or specialty textiles.
Your needle may be the problem if:
The machine makes a popping sound as the needle enters the fabric
The thread breaks frequently
Stitches are skipped or uneven
The needle deflects or bends during sewing
The fabric puckers or pulls downward
The machine jams at thick seams
Use the correct needle size and type for the material. For example, lightweight cotton may require a universal needle in a smaller size, while denim may require a stronger denim needle. Stretch fabrics often sew better with a ballpoint or stretch needle. Leather, vinyl, embroidery, quilting, and heavy upholstery fabrics may each require specialized needles.
As a general practice, replace the needle after several hours of sewing or when starting an important project. Also, make sure the needle is inserted fully and facing the correct direction according to the machine’s design.
Tension Problems Can Create Thread Nests
Thread tension helps balance the upper and lower threads, so stitches form evenly in the fabric. If the upper tension is too loose, loops may collect underneath the fabric. If the tension is too tight, thread can snap, pull, or distort the fabric. Bobbin tension can also contribute to jamming, though it should be adjusted carefully and only when necessary.
Before changing tension settings, check the basics:
Rethread the upper thread path
Remove and reinsert the bobbin
Clean the bobbin area
Replace the needle
Test with quality thread and scrap fabric
Confirm the presser foot is lowered before sewing
Many tension problems are actually threading problems. If the thread is not seated properly, changing the dial may not solve the issue. Once the machine is correctly threaded and clean, test stitches on a fabric scrap that matches your project. Make small adjustments and note the results.
Lint and Debris Can Block Smooth Operation
Sewing machines naturally collect lint, dust, and thread fibers. Cotton, fleece, flannel, batting, and some heavy fabrics produce more lint than others. Over time, this buildup can interfere with the hook, bobbin case, feed dogs, and needle plate. A dirty machine may jam even if it is threaded correctly.
Regular cleaning should include:
Removing the needle plate when appropriate
Brushing lint from the feed dogs
Cleaning around the bobbin case
Removing loose thread pieces
Checking the hook area for wrapped thread
Following the manufacturer’s oiling instructions if oiling is required
Avoid using canned air unless the manufacturer specifically recommends it. In many machines, compressed air can push lint deeper into the mechanism. A small brush, soft cloth, and proper maintenance routine are usually better choices.
Fabric Handling Can Cause Jams
Sometimes the problem is not inside the machine. Fabric handling can also cause jamming. Pulling or pushing fabric while sewing can bend the needle, interfere with the feed dogs, and throw off stitch formation. The machine is designed to move the fabric at a controlled pace. Your job is to guide the fabric, not force it.
Fabric-related causes of jamming include:
Sewing too fast over thick seams
Pulling the fabric from behind the presser foot
Starting too close to the fabric edge
Using the wrong presser foot
Sewing fabric that is too thick for the machine
Failing to stabilize delicate, stretchy, or slippery fabric
Using a stitch length that is too short for the material
When sewing thick areas, slow down and let the machine work. Use the correct needle, thread, and presser foot. For very bulky seams, a leveling tool or folded scrap of fabric behind the presser foot can help keep the foot even as it climbs over thickness changes.
Thread Quality Matters More Than Many People Think
Low-quality thread can create a surprising number of problems. Thread that is old, brittle, fuzzy, uneven, or poorly wound may shed lint, break under tension, or fail to move smoothly through the thread path. This can cause jams, skipped stitches, and inconsistent stitch quality.
Good thread should:
Feed smoothly from the spool
Have consistent thickness
Resist easy breaking
Match the fabric and needle size
Produce minimal lint
Be appropriate for the type of sewing being done
Old thread may look usable, but it breaks easily when pulled. If your machine jams repeatedly with one spool but sews well with another, the thread may be the issue.
The Machine May Be Out of Timing
If basic troubleshooting does not solve the problem, the machine may have a mechanical issue such as timing misalignment. Timing refers to the precise relationship between the needle and hook. The hook must meet the needle at the correct moment to catch the thread loop and form a stitch. If the timing is off, the machine may skip stitches, break needles, jam, or fail to sew at all.
Timing problems may happen after:
A needle strikes a pin, zipper, or presser foot
The machine is forced through thick fabric
A jam is pulled loose aggressively
Internal gears or parts become worn
The machine has not been serviced in a long time
Timing adjustment is usually not a beginner repair. It requires mechanical understanding, proper tools, and knowledge of the machine’s design. If you suspect timing issues, professional training or qualified service is recommended.
What to Do Immediately When Your Sewing Machine Jams
When your machine jams, stop sewing right away. Continuing to press the foot pedal can make the problem worse.
Follow these steps:
Turn off the machine
Raise the presser foot if possible
Carefully remove the fabric without pulling aggressively
Cut tangled threads rather than forcing them loose
Remove the bobbin and bobbin case if accessible
Check for broken needle pieces
Clean out thread nests and lint
Replace the needle if there is any doubt
Rethread the entire machine
Test on scrap fabric before returning to the project
Never force the handwheel if it will not move. A locked handwheel may indicate thread wrapped around internal parts or a more serious mechanical obstruction. Forcing it can damage gears, shafts, timing components, or the hook assembly.
How to Prevent Future Sewing Machine Jams
Preventing jams is easier than fixing them after they happen. A consistent setup and maintenance routine can help your machine perform more reliably.
Best practices include:
Use the correct needle for the fabric
Replace needles regularly
Use the right bobbin for the machine
Wind bobbins evenly
Thread the machine with the presser foot raised
Hold thread tails when starting a seam if your machine requires it
Clean the bobbin area often
Use quality thread
Avoid sewing over pins
Do not pull or force fabric
Schedule regular maintenance
Learn the specific mechanics of your machine model
A sewing machine is a precision tool. The more you understand how its systems work together, the easier it becomes to diagnose issues before they become costly problems.
FAQ
Why does my sewing machine jam underneath the fabric?
Thread bunching underneath the fabric is usually caused by incorrect upper threading, loose upper tension, a missed take-up lever, or the presser foot being lowered during threading. Rethread the machine with the presser foot raised and check the bobbin area for tangles.
Can the wrong bobbin make my sewing machine jam?
Yes. Using the wrong bobbin can affect thread delivery, tension, and stitch formation. Always use the bobbin size and style recommended for your machine model.
How often should I change my sewing machine needle?
Change the needle after several hours of sewing, after completing a large project, or anytime you notice skipped stitches, popping sounds, thread breakage, or fabric damage.
Why does my machine jam when I sew thick fabric?
Thick fabric can cause needle deflection, uneven feeding, tension strain, and timing stress. Use the correct needle, sew slowly, choose an appropriate presser foot, and avoid forcing the fabric.
Is thread quality really important?
Yes. Poor-quality, old, or fuzzy thread can break, shed lint, and create tension problems. Quality thread helps the machine sew more smoothly and reduces the risk of jams.
Should I oil my sewing machine if it keeps jamming?
Only oil your machine if the manufacturer recommends it and only in the specified locations. Some modern machines are not designed for user oiling. Cleaning should always come before oiling.
When should I seek professional repair training or service?
If your machine keeps jamming after you have checked threading, bobbin placement, needle condition, tension, and cleanliness, there may be a mechanical issue. Timing, hook damage, gear problems, or internal thread wrapping may require deeper repair knowledge.
